Timing diagrams in digital electronics tutorial pdf

We could not finish this 555 timer tutorial without discussing something about the switching and drive capabilities of the 555 timer or indeed the dual 556 timer ic. Walker competitive design of modern digital circuits requires high performance at reduced cost and timetomarket. The number of flipflops used and the way in which they are connected determine the number of states and also the specific sequence of states that the counter goes through during each complete cycle. Draw beautiful digital electronics timing diagrams in latex. This timer circuit is similar to the 5 to 30 minute timer except that when switch s1 is closed, the onoff action of the circuit will continue indefinitely until s1 is opened again. Due to variations in driver output impedance problems in clock distribution usually a clock timing terminology 4 digital design nomenclature for timing diagrams. Timing diagrams explain digital circuitry functioning during time flow. Either way sequential logic circuits can be divided into the following three main categories.

The circuits studied up to this point have been entirely based on combinational logic circuits. And i am drawing a lot of timing diagrams for which i am using microsoft excel, as it is easy to import into word document. Oct 29, 2014 the only problem with tikztiming is a shortage of examples. Timing diagrams help to understand how digital circuits or sub circuits should work or fit in to larger circuit system. They also serve as valuable documentation to others who might use your design later. Draw the timing diagram using a pulse for each logic 1 and a space for each logic 0. Digital electronics part i combinational and sequential logic dr. There are horizontal lines representing the voltage levels and signals, then there are vertical lines representing time. This means that in clocked circuits the outputs do not change as soon as the inputs change but must wait for a clock.

Timing diagram basics each component you will encounter that communicates over a serial connection, will require understanding the timing of those interactions. A 7555 time and low leakage type capacitor for c1 must. In digital electronics, what are timing diagrams used for. Create timing diagrams easily with timinganalyzer win,linux. This diagram is like the london underground map it shows how things connect in a way that allows you to see the underlying pattern without the complexity of how things are physically laid out in the real. Digital electronics 1sequential circuit counters 1. The package documentation has but a handful, and they dont look much like realworld timing diagrams. Wavedrom draws your timing diagram or waveform from simple textual description.

Detailed explanation along with various t states, machine cycle and. May 29, 2006 timing diagrams are the main key in understanding digital systems. Resembles a set of square waves, each sitting on its xaxis. Electronics tutorial and circuits basic and advanced. One notable feature lacking in my diagrams is the delay cyclesmost books youll read on pci, in addition to the. Before go for timing diagram of 8085 microprocessor we should know some basic parameters to draw timing diagram of 8085 microprocessor. Clocks and timing signals most sequential logic circuits are driven by a clock oscillator. Digital electronics 1sequential circuit counters such a group of flip flops is a counter. Circuits with flipflop sequential circuit circuit state. Understanding timing diagrams of digital systems do it. Timing diagrams are the main key in understanding digital systems.

The solution to these problems is to provide a timing or clock signal that allows all of the flipflops of the chained circuits to switch simultaneously. It comes with description language, rendering engine and the editor. Basic electronics and electrical tutorials and guides chapter wise fro electrical and electronics engineering students. So learning how to read timing diagrams may increase your work with digital systems and.

Algebraic manipulation as seen in examples karnaugh k mapping a visual approach tabular approaches usually implemented by computer, e. The timing diagram is used for a few different purposes, all of which are very important in digital circuit design. Jul 16, 20 you can even export the digital timing diagrams in any file type like pdf, svg, png or jpeg. The timing diagram is the diagram which provides information about the various conditions of signals such as highlow, when a machine cycle is being executed. The chargedischarge time of capacitors is controlled using resistors. But, things are getting more and more difficult with excel. You likely carry some sort of device designed with them with you nearly all.

Understanding timing diagrams of digital systems do it easy. The stored data can be changed by applying varying inputs. Digital electronics part i combinational and sequential logic. Wavedrom editor works in the browser or can be installed on your system. Electronics tutorial and circuits basic and advanced electronics beginners and intermediate electronics engineering hobby science projects terms dictionary and conversions general theory, test and measurement, digital circuits, battery tutorials, stepper motor system basics, how to use a multimeter, components symbols, dc theory, block diagrams, switches tutorial. You likely carry some sort of device designed with them with you nearly all your waking hours whether it is a watch, cell phone, mp3 player or pda. Figure 2b shows the circuit which can be used to show the amplifying properties of the transistor. This tool helps us debug the behavior of our implemented circuits. It is a tool that is commonly used in digital electronics, hardware debugging, and digital communications. Most of the registers possess no characteristic internal sequence of states. So learning how to read timing diagrams may increase your work with digital systems and integrate them.

This usually consists of an astable circuit producing regular pulses that should ideally. Sep 14, 2011 introduction to the digital logic tool. Later, we will study circuits having a stored internal state, i. Introduction to digital logic with laboratory exercises. Timing diagrams attempt to break these parts up in a way that allows you to understand what needs to be sent or received and in what sequence that needs to happen. The timing diagrams are just copied directly from that manual, which isnt useful. A timing diagram can contain many rows, usually one of them being the clock. Timing diagrams are often used in electrical engineering.

Yet even outside of some of these obvious applications we find that our cars and utilitarian home appliances such as microwaves, washers, dryers, coffee makers and even refrigerators are all increasingly being designed with digital electronic controls. Circuits with flipflop sequential circuit circuit state diagram state table state minimizationstate minimization sequential circuit design. Timing diagram plays an essential role in matching the peripherals with the microprocessor. The waveforms show how the state of the signal changes with time. Appreciate the detailed explanation of timing diagram for various signals including status signals,ale signal,rd and wr signal, higher order and lower order address signals and data signal. Memory basics and timing massachusetts institute of. With the help of timing diagram we can understand the working of any system, step by step working of each instruction and its execution, etc. For example, you should be able to draw the timing diagrams for output signals given the input stimuli, or write down the sequence of states that the circuit must go through. Capacitors take time to charge and discharge, according to the amount of current. Digital electronics timing diagrams logic gate electronic. The timing diagram represents the clock cycle and duration, delay, content of address bus and data bus, type of operation ie.

The pci timing diagrams are drawn with reference to version 2. Consequently the output is solely a function of the current inputs. Timing diagrams wisconline oer this website uses cookies to ensure you get the best experience on our website. Work through the tutorial to learn how to use multisim to simulate a simple digital logic circuit. The main objective of this lab is to introduce the students to simple digital devices and their operations. You can even export the digital timing diagrams in any file type like pdf, svg, png or jpeg. Glitches and hazards in digital circuits john knight electronics department, carleton university printed. Without the knowledge of timing diagram it is not possible to match the peripheral devices to the microprocessors. A flip flop is an electronic circuit with two stable states that can be used to store binary data.

Flipflops and latches are fundamental building blocks of digital electronics systems used in computers, communications, and many other types of systems. Timing diagram basics rheingold heavyrheingold heavy. It is the graphical representation of process in steps with respect to time. Timing analysis is increasingly used to deal with the. Work through the tutorial to learn how to use multisim to simulate a simple digital logic.

Nonetheless, when designing digital circuits we can largely ignore the underlying physics and focus most of our attention on how to combine components in a way that produces a desired logical behavior. Periodic timer circuit tutorial a switched timer with equal make and equal space periods timing adjustable from over 6 minutes to 38 minutes. Create timing diagrams easily with timinganalyzer win. But, if there are no timing restrictions in how the systems are driven, meaning. To increase the storage capacity in terms of number of bits, we have to use a g. Think of the timing diagram as looking at the face of an oscilloscope. Digital electronics part i combinational and sequential. If you do electronics design, especially digital circuits, youll eventually find yourselfdrawing timing diagrams showing the clock, control and data waveforms.

The threshold input pin 6 is connected to ground to ensure that it cannot reset the bistable circuit as it would in a normal timing application. They are used for analysing logic circuits to determine operation. Flipflop is a 1 bit memory cell which can be used for storing the digital data. With help of timing diagram we can easily calculate the execution time of instruction as well as program. They help you clarify the sequencing of data and control signals as they pass through your circuit. Understand synchronous digital systems if you are given a circuit with gates and flipflops, you should be able to predict how it behaves.

Timing diagrams and applications of logic circuits by n. A digital timing diagram is a representation of a set of signals in the time domain. Aims to familiarise students with combinational logic circuits sequential logic circuits how digital logic gates are built using transistors design and build of digital logic systems. Timing diagrams show timing relationships between different signals inside an electronic circuit. Basic memory circuits background introduction to memory circuits memory circuits can largely be seperated into two major groups. Together they illustrate all logic states of all inputs and the output over a period of time. In this case the best time interval would be 5ns per each vertical line since this is the shortest delay time shown and 10ns is divisible by 5ns.

The most obvious purpose in your class is to show how the system will respond over time to changing inputs, and to help you get a. They will also be introduced to the procedure of building simple digital circuits using a digital design kit. This sort of circuit has the state of its output change when the input states change. Electronics tutorial and circuits basic and advanced electronics beginners and intermediate electronics engineering hobby science projects terms dictionary and conversions general theory, test and measurement, digital circuits, battery tutorials, stepper motor system basics, how to use a multimeter, components symbols, dc theory, block diagrams, switches tutorial, music, sound. They are a group of flipflops connected in a chain so that the output from one flipflop becomes the input of the next flipflop. Sequential logic circuits can be constructed to produce either simple edgetriggered flipflops or more complex sequential circuits such as storage registers, shift registers, memory devices or counters.

To understand electronic circuits it is normal to draw a circuit diagram or schematic. Either way sequential logic circuits can be divided into. It provides ataglance evaluation of system performance and can offer insight into the. Introduction to digital logic devices this is the first lab session. In electronic circuit diagrams the power supply is usually not shown, and we will continue this convention.

They consist of signal waveforms and timing parameters like delays, setups, and holds. Note that in this figure we have not detailed the power supply. Circuit,g, state diagram, state table circuits with flipflop sequential circuit circuit state diagram state table state minimizationstate minimization. The explanation and use of timing diagrams used in digital electronics to graphically show the operation of various circuits are given. To increase the storage capacity in terms of number of bits, we have to use a group of flipflop. Digital registers flipflop is a 1 bit memory cell which can be used for storing the digital data. Timing analysis of logiclevel digital circuits using uncertainty intervals.